The distributive property for multiplication is as follows :

a(b+c) = ab + ac

We need to evaluate 6 times 49 i.e. 6(49).

We can write 49 as (50-1)

6(50-1) = 6(50+(-1))

Here, a = 6, b = 50 and c = -1

So,

6(50+(-1)) = 6(50) + 6(-1)

= 300-6

= 294
